About the role

We are recruiting for a new Drainage Engineer to work in our Patching and Lining team for the Southern Water contract covering the whole of Sussex. The role requires working flexible hours, weekends, and participation in an on‑call rota. Full training, PPE, and company equipment will be provided.

Responsibilities

  • Travel to residential sites via a specially equipped van in a two‑person team within the region.
  • Repair and maintain drainage systems, installing patch liners to carry out first‑time‑fix sewer and drain repair.
  • Utilise the Picote system to remove scale, roots, concrete and other hard obstructions that high‑pressure water jetting systems can’t remove.
  • Survey the network of drainage systems and assess pipe conditions to produce high‑quality reports using state‑of‑the‑art drain surveying equipment.
